About This Access Site
The Cedar River Take Out is a whitewater access point located in the Town of Indian Lake within Hamilton County in the Adirondack region of New York. This take out serves paddlers completing whitewater runs on the Cedar River, providing a designated spot to exit the water after downstream travel. The site is positioned at coordinates 43.75249900, -74.06079900 in a rural Adirondack setting known for its recreational paddling opportunities.
As a dedicated take out for whitewater paddling, this site is primarily suited for kayakers and canoeists running the Cedar River during appropriate water conditions. Paddlers using this access point should be familiar with whitewater river conditions and have the necessary skills for the sections of river upstream. The Indian Lake area offers access to classic Adirondack paddling with scenic mountain views typical of the region.
